The Allegations Against Ray Epps and Fox News' Coverage

Fox News personalities and guests repeatedly linked Ray Epps to the planning and execution of the January 6th attack. These claims, Epps argues, were not only false but also deliberately misleading. The network's coverage portrayed Epps, a former member of the Oath Keepers, as an undercover FBI informant, inciting violence against the Capitol. This narrative was amplified across multiple platforms, reaching a vast audience.

  • Example 1: Segments on Tucker Carlson Tonight repeatedly aired footage of Epps urging individuals to go to the Capitol building the day before the attack. This footage was presented without context, suggesting incitement rather than simply observing or commenting on events.
  • Example 2: Sean Hannity and other Fox News hosts echoed and amplified these allegations, further embedding the false narrative into the public consciousness.
  • Example 3: The repetition and amplification of these false claims, spread over numerous broadcasts and across various platforms, created a powerful and damaging narrative against Ray Epps. This consistent and coordinated effort to portray Epps as a villain is central to his defamation claim.

Epps' Legal Strategy and the Defamation Claim

Epps' lawsuit centers on the legal definition of defamation. He must prove that Fox News made a false statement about him, published it to a third party, acted with fault (actual malice in this case, given Epps' status as a public figure), and that the statement caused him damages. His legal team is aggressively pursuing this strategy, citing instances of clear negligence and intentional misrepresentation.

  • Actual Malice: Given Epps is considered a public figure, Epps must prove that Fox News acted with "actual malice," meaning they knew the statements were false or recklessly disregarded whether they were true or false. This is a high bar, but Epps’ legal team argues they have sufficient evidence to meet it.
  • Potential Damages: The damages Epps seeks are substantial, encompassing both monetary losses and the irreparable harm to his reputation caused by Fox News' broadcasts.
  • Legal Precedents: The lawsuit will likely rely on established defamation case law, specifically concerning media outlets and their responsibility for the accuracy of their reporting.
